TinyMCE 是一个流行的富文本编辑器,它允许用户在网页上进行所见即所得的编辑。保存样式是指在编辑器中应用的格式和样式能够在保存后仍然保留。以下是在 TinyMCE 中保存样式的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案。
基础概念
在 TinyMCE 中,样式通常指的是文本的格式,如字体、颜色、对齐方式等。保存样式意味着这些格式在编辑器中应用后,能够被正确地保存到数据库或文件中,并在再次加载时恢复。
优势
- 用户体验:用户在编辑器中设置的样式能够被完整地保留,提供更好的编辑体验。
- 一致性:确保内容在不同平台和设备上显示一致。
- 减少工作量:编辑者无需在每次加载内容时重新设置样式。
类型
TinyMCE 支持多种样式类型,包括但不限于:
- 文本格式:粗体、斜体、下划线等。
- 颜色和背景:文本颜色、背景颜色等。
- 对齐方式:左对齐、居中、右对齐等。
- 列表:有序列表、无序列表等。
应用场景
- 内容管理系统(CMS):在 CMS 中编辑文章或页面时保存样式。
- 博客平台:博主在编写博客时应用和保存样式。
- 企业文档:在企业内部系统中编辑文档时保持格式一致。
可能遇到的问题及解决方案
问题:样式在保存后丢失
原因:
- 保存逻辑不正确,没有正确捕获和应用样式。
- 数据库或文件存储时格式不正确。
- 编辑器配置问题,导致样式没有被正确处理。
解决方案:
- 检查保存逻辑:确保在保存内容时,所有应用的样式都被正确捕获并保存到数据库或文件中。
- 检查保存逻辑:确保在保存内容时,所有应用的样式都被正确捕获并保存到数据库或文件中。
- 验证存储格式:检查数据库或文件中的内容,确保样式信息被正确存储。
- 配置编辑器:确保 TinyMCE 的配置正确,特别是
content_css
和 toolbar
等选项。 - 配置编辑器:确保 TinyMCE 的配置正确,特别是
content_css
和 toolbar
等选项。
问题:样式在加载时没有恢复
原因:
- 加载逻辑不正确,没有正确应用保存的样式。
- 数据库或文件中的样式信息损坏或不完整。
- 编辑器配置问题,导致样式没有被正确恢复。
解决方案:
- 检查加载逻辑:确保在加载内容时,所有保存的样式都被正确应用。
- 检查加载逻辑:确保在加载内容时,所有保存的样式都被正确应用。
- 验证数据完整性:检查数据库或文件中的内容,确保样式信息完整且未损坏。
- 配置编辑器:确保 TinyMCE 的配置正确,特别是
content_css
和 toolbar
等选项。
参考链接
通过以上步骤,您应该能够在 TinyMCE 中正确地保存和恢复样式。如果问题仍然存在,建议查看 TinyMCE 的官方文档或社区论坛以获取更多帮助。